In a developing story from Chinchilla, Queensland, an 18-year-old man has been arrested and charged following an armed robbery at a local tobacco store. The incident occurred on August 23, when the suspect allegedly entered the store on the Warrego Highway armed with a knife and a black backpack, demanding cigarettes from a female employee.

According to police reports, the confrontation escalated as the suspect tore down a screen divider, leaped over the counter, and helped himself to a quantity of cigarettes before fleeing the scene. The employee was unharmed during the incident.

Authorities swiftly acted on the case, executing a search warrant the following day, which led to the suspect’s apprehension and the recovery of the stolen goods. The man, from Chinchilla, faces multiple charges, including robbery and wilful damage. He remains in custody and is scheduled to appear in the Dalby Magistrates Court on August 25.
